Botanical Solutions Engages New York City Based Public Relations Firm to Launch Nationwide Communications Outreach

April 11, 2006 - New York, NY -- Botanical Solutions, Inc., a Myrtle Beach, South Carolina based venture capital firm specializing in Health and Medical related initiatives and disciplines has engaged The Weiser Group, a New York City based Public Relations firm, to spearhead their nationwide communications roll-out and outreach.

With offices in Chicago, New York and Washington, D.C., The Weiser Group helps corporations; financial institutions and associations build, enhance, and defend their brands.  In over 25 years of providing strategic communications counsel, The Weiser Group has represented every major U.S. securities and futures exchange, as well as served clients in healthcare, technology, private equity, financial services, and other specialized industries.  The firm’s principals work closely with clients to develop communications strategies to meet their branding goals. 

“Michael Weiser, the Chairman of The Weiser Group, helped initiate and publicize the health benefits of Vitamin E when working with the world’s largest producer of natural source Vitamin E, the Henkel Corporation, for over six years,” said Donald Wizeman, Senior Vice President of Botanical Solutions, Inc. “The Weiser Group’s extensive experience with such clients as Henkel, the Chicago Stock Exchange, Deloitte & Touché, Humana, IBM and other blue chip corporations give us confidence in their ability to dramatically raise the awareness of Botanical Solutions’ projects and initiatives, especially as to how they address environmental pollution’s devastating effects on the human body both internally and externally,” Wizeman continued.

Botanical Solutions is led by internationally recognized dermatologist and researcher Robert D. Bibb, M.D., a pioneer in environmental dermatology and pollution’s damaging effects on the skin.

“Botanical Solutions has first-mover advantage in developing products to address dermatological and other health problems posed by environmental pollutions. We look forward to making the public aware of Botanical Solutions’ many exciting projects, including forthcoming cosmeceutical and nutrition supplement products,” said Michael Weiser, Chairman of The Weiser Group.
